Symptoms

  • •Vibration felt through the brake pedal when braking
  • •Steering wheel shakes during braking
  • •Uneven wear on brake pads or rotors
  • •Noise such as grinding or squeaking when braking
  • •Vehicle pulls to one side when braking

Solution
1. Preparation
  • Gather tools and materials.
  • Ensure the vehicle is parked on a level surface and the parking brake is engaged.
  • Disconnect the negative battery terminal for safety.
2. Remove Wheel
  • Use a jack to lift the vehicle and secure it with jack stands.
  • Remove lug nuts using a socket set and take off the wheel.
3. Inspect and Replace Brake Pads
  • Remove the caliper bolts using a socket wrench.
  • Carefully lift the caliper off the rotor without disconnecting the brake line.
  • Inspect the brake pads for wear; replace if they are below the manufacturer's minimum thickness.
  • Install new brake pads, ensuring they are positioned correctly in the caliper bracket.
4. Inspect and Resurface/Replace Rotors
  • Measure rotor thickness with a micrometer; if below specifications, replace.
  • If rotors are within spec but warped, use a brake lathe to resurface them.
  • Clean the rotor surface with brake cleaner and install back onto the hub.
5. Reassemble and Test
  • Reattach the caliper over the new pads and tighten the caliper bolts to the manufacturer’s torque specifications.
  • Reinstall the wheel and lug nuts, tightening them in a crisscross pattern.
  • Lower the vehicle back to the ground and reconnect the negative battery terminal.
